Output 85be320eb06174591d569a49dcd5a2ee431b25930d6c16437c29e4cdb0923f9a:2

value
76504553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 575e87027efbea428c4c0837b78bd86a179b382f OP_EQUALVERIFY OP_CHECKSIG
address
18xy2ZsyvRwnirY8UuSi3M2x6y4nhu5qXS
transaction
85be320eb06174591d569a49dcd5a2ee431b25930d6c16437c29e4cdb0923f9a
spent
true